Booking Holdings (NASDAQ: BKNG) is the world's leading provider of online travel and related services, provided to consumers and local partners in more than 220 countries and territories through five primary consumer-facing brands: Booking.com, Priceline, Agoda, KAYAK and OpenTable. The mission of Booking Holdings is to make it easier for everyone to experience the world. We're hiring an experienced Corporate Governance Paralegal to partner with our securities, financing, and corporate governance attorneys on high-impact matters. You'll drive key workstreams across the governance, securities law, financing, and board spaces – all as part of our Company’s mission to make it easier for everyone to experience the world. You'll interface frequently with senior executives, multiple functions, and internal and external counsel across our global organization. In this role you will get to:

  • Collaborate with the Legal team on SEC filings and keep our corporate governance policies organized and state-of-the-art.

  • Keep our board of directors and committee meeting agendas, material reviews, distributions, and administrative tasks humming along on schedule;

  • Lead records management for our board and committee materials;

  • Manage workstreams related to our board meetings and annual stockholders’ meeting;

  • Facilitate internal subsidiary management and corporate governance, including intercompany transactions, formation of subsidiaries, corporate governance filings such as statutory audits, drafting of resolutions, corporate minute books, and records management;

  • Support the team's efforts around the Company's Insider Trading Policy, Section 16 filings, and corporate delegations of authority;

  • Navigate cross-border requirements for execution and certification of various corporate documents and filings; 

  • Jump in on financing or similar transactions and projects as needed; and

  • Additional corporate paralegal responsibilities and ad hoc projects with the Legal team.

What you have:

  • Bachelor's Degree

  • 6+ years of corporate paralegal experience. Experience in a publicly traded company is strongly preferred

  • Flawless written and verbal communication abilities;

  • Self-starter mentality that will look for ways to add value and ease administrative friction. 

  • Detailed knowledge of the legal department, as well as a general understanding of the Company operations, organization, and procedures

  • Attention to detail

  • Demonstrated experience with SEC filing requirements, including Section 16 filings and the annual proxy process

  • Advanced knowledge of corporate secretarial functions, including drafting board resolutions, maintaining minute books, and managing domestic/international subsidiary compliance.

  • Experience with SEC filing and board management tools

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
